Liability

If you sustain severe injuries as a result of a semi truck accident law firm-truck accident, medical bills as well as other losses could be overwhelming. To ensure that you receive the full amount you're due it is important to determine who's responsible for your losses. This can be done by a lawyer with expertise in truck accidents. Based on the circumstances of your accident, you may be able to hold several parties accountable for your damages and losses.

An exhaustive investigation is conducted to determine who is at fault. This includes interviewing witnesses, taking pictures of the scene for reconstruction and then reviewing the company's logbooks and records. During this time, your lawyer may have experts look over the truck and its components as well as any other issues that contributed to accident. This process is time-consuming and costly, yet it is crucial in determining the facts of your case.

The driver may be liable for injuries you sustained when they were distracted or speeding or driving recklessly through intersections and sharp turns and failing to take required breaks. In some instances the trucker's employer could be held accountable for their actions. This is particularly true when they have unreasonably long delivery schedules that make drivers work over their safety limits.

Trucking companies are also liable for accidents that result because of improper loading and shipping, or the inability to secure cargo. For instance, if a load shifts during travel it could cause a truck to jackknife and hit motorists. A truck's cargo could also explode if it has not been secured or loaded in conformity with federal regulations.

A crash caused by a defective truck part or poor maintenance could cause an action in court. A semi truck accident law firm truck accident lawyer can review the evidence to determine the incident. In certain cases the manufacturer of the semi-truck or trailer or the mechanic who maintained the vehicle, or even third parties that provided the vehicle's component may be liable.

During the course of litigation in which all parties are involved, they will engage in what is called discovery. During this time, your lawyers may swap documents, photos and witness statements.

Damages

Six million accidents happen on US roads every year. These incidents can cause minor property damage, however they can also cause serious injuries to a lot of victims. Fortunately, victims may recover compensation for their losses by filing a claim with the responsible party. The process involves proving that the responsible party was under the duty of care to ensure your safety and violated the duty by committing a negligent act. This involves showing that the negligent act caused you to suffer harm.

In the aftermath of a semi-truck accident victims typically suffer various injuries. These include medical bills, pain and suffering, loss of income, and other expenses related to the incident. Victims often have to pay for long-term care expenses to manage their injuries.

A personal injury lawyer with experience can offer valuable guidance in determining how much compensation you should be receiving. They can look over your medical records and other documentation to provide a complete picture of the financial and non-financial impact of the accident. This information will aid your lawyer in determining how much a reasonable settlement should be.

Large trucks can cause massive damage in a crash because they are so massive. This is especially true particularly if the truck is operating recklessly or carrying a shaky cargo. Other causes of accidents involving trucks are rear-end crashes as well as jackknife collisions. In a rear-end crash, the rear bumper of a truck or its side can crash into the back of a smaller vehicle. In a jackknife accident the trailer of a truck may fold down under the rear bumper of a different vehicle or on to an object in the road.

Truck accident lawsuits are a complex matter and require a thorough pre-planning process to win a trial. This includes preparing witnesses, writing jury instructions, identifying possible issues, and researching state and federal laws which apply to a particular case.

Expert witnesses can help an attorney create an intriguing argument for trial. They could be doctors or actuaries, as well as vocational and traffic engineers. It is also essential to gather any evidence that could prove the at-fault driver's negligence. For example, a violation of trucking regulations could be a strong indication of negligence.

Photographs and videos taken at the site of a collision can provide evidence of an attorney's case. It is especially important to record images of skid marks or road conditions. It is also a good idea to discuss the incident with witnesses present at the incident.

A successful insurance claim requires evidence that the party at fault was negligent. This could include proof that the trucker was in violation of state or federal regulations. Invalid commercial driver's licence could be a clear indication of negligence.

Preparing for trial may take several weeks or even months. A lawyer must go through the evidence, formulate a theory for the case, and then prepare to cross-examine. Witnesses must be screened and prepared, and subpoenas should be issued when necessary.
